					<description><![CDATA[A couple of years ago, I had two professional conferences in Europe that were a week apart, so we decided to make the most of it! We spent a month in climates ranging from the mid-90s to the mid-60s and packed it all very comfortably in a 21” carryon. The first 2 weeks were the hottest, where we traveled to 6 different locations in Italy as part of a process workshop. We had the next week entirely to ourselves, so we went to southeastern coast of Spain to visit our former exchange student where the temps were more moderate, in the 80s. The biggest packing challenge was that the last week was a professional conference in Edinburgh, where the temps reached a high of only 60, and where we also wanted to do some hiking and did a half day boat trip to Bass Rock to see puffins. With the exception of a gorgeous leather jacket I bought in Italy and a long-sleeved pullover I bought at a charity shop in Edinburgh, I packed everything in that little carryon because my personal item had to hold my computer and things for the actual conferences. It might not have worked, but we were able to hand wash light things in Italy and had full laundry facilities in our flat in Torrevieja. (We couldn’t afford a honeymoon when we got married and since this coincided with our 40th wedding anniversary, we decided to make the most of it! Absolutely zero regrets!)]]></description>
